Security Strategy for Oil & Gas Facilities

📝 General Introduction

Oil and gas facilities are among the most critical and strategically sensitive infrastructures in the global energy landscape.

These facilities—whether onshore or offshore—operate in complex, high-risk environments and face a wide range of security threats including sabotage, operational accidents, cyberattacks, and geopolitical risks.

Securing oil and gas assets requires a comprehensive strategy that integrates physical protection, cybersecurity, risk management, emergency response, and coordination with government and regulatory bodies.
